Default Fastech 312 sound system

I'm new on this forum so this is my first post. I hope I can upload some pictures of the boat.
My system is installed on a 2001 fastech 312. I have 2 Kinetik batteries 3800 and 3 Kinetik 2400. They are charged by a CAE APS-75 Battery charger.

The brain of the system is the Audison Bit one processor. The processor receives digital optical signal from the Eclipse 55090 DVD unit. Also receives digital coaxial signal from the Eclipse CD changer. The third signal that the processor receives is analog signal from a pioneer DEH-80PRS. To the pioneer head unit I can connect any kind of iPod, IPhone, IPad, usb cards. Petty much any type of audio source that I can connect via usb, also pandora from the iPhone.

The amplifiers are 3 Alpine PDX-4.150 and one PDX-1.600.
For highs I have 3 pairs of horn tweeters Selenium ST-350. For mids I used 2 pairs of Image Dynamics horns. For mid-bass I used a set of Digital Designs 6.5 midbass. For woofers I used 4 JL audio M10-IB5. And for Sub-woofer I made a ported enclosure for a Digital Designs 15" ref1515a.

Also I installed a pair of JL audio M7.7 components.
It sounds clean and loud.
